[0018] A kind of breeding method of Yunnan-Guizhou water leek; Concrete steps are as follows:

[0019] (1) Production and sterilization of the culture box

[0020] Spread absorbent cotton with a thickness of 1cm evenly in a well-sealed transparent plastic box with a length of 30cm, a width of 20cm, and a height of 12cm; then spread a layer of filter paper on the absorbent cotton; moisten the absorbent cotton and filter paper with MS medium, and use just enough saturated with filter paper; the result is a culture box (such as figure 1 shown); put the culture box in a sterilizing pot, and sterilize by high-pressure steam at 121°C for 20 minutes.

[0021] (2) Disinfection of Yunnan-Guizhou Shuiyu megaspores

Abstract

The invention discloses a reproduction method of isoetes yunguiensis. The method comprises the steps that spores of the isoetes yunguiensis are inoculated in a cultivation box for cultivating after disinfection, and then are transplanted and subjected to field planting management in a manual culture pond, and eventually mature sporophytes are obtained. With the adoption of the reproduction method of the isoetes yunguiensis, a small quantity of spore materials are utilized to reproduce a large quantity of sporophytes rapidly, juvenile sporophyte seedlings can be obtained in 70 days, mature sporophytes can be obtained in 210 days, and field planting survival rate can reach 50%. According to the reproduction method of the isoetes yunguiensis, large-scale reproduction of the isoetes yunguiensis is realized, and the defect that a resource of the isoetes yunguiensis can be obtained only from a wild environment in the past is overcome, so that the requirement of scientific research activities for the resource of the isoetes yunguiensis is met, the ex-situ conservation of the isoetes yunguiensis is possible, simultaneously, damage to wild resources and environment can be reduced, and the reproduction method of the isoetes yunguiensis has a wide application prospect.

technical field [0001] The invention relates to a plant propagation method, in particular to a reproduction method of Yunnan-Guizhou water leek. Background technique [0002] Isoetes is a relict genus of Isoetaceae, which is an ancient aquatic or semi-aquatic fern, which originated between the late Devonian and early Carboniferous, and is of great importance in botanical research. value. The stems of the plants of the genus Lime are short and thick, and the leaves are long and narrow. There are sporangia at the base of the leaves, which produce megaspores and microspores. The two kinds of spores form female and male gametophytes respectively, and cooperate with each other to complete the sexual reproduction process. There are only about 200 species of water allium in the world, mainly in the northern hemisphere.
